Mrs. Nevin belongs to Reese Creek Extension unit, and Eagle Point Parent Teacher association. A V 1 V.I Iti 4 Twelve-year-old Jennifer, a seventh-grader, and Donna, 10 years old arid in th fourth d'ode at Eagle Point school, both belong to cooking, sewing and beef-raising 4H clubs. Jennifer is already training her Hereford steer. Rawhide, for showing in the 4H Fair next summer and brought him up from the barn last week .to see how he would react to posing for the cameraman. Today, American mothers "will be honored and pampered; on other days they keep busy with the hundreds of tasks which are necessary to v keep a house-hold running smoothly. The Phillip Nevins and their four children live on a farm off Hammel road, Eagle Point, and Mrs. Nevin is almost always home when Jennifer, (center) and Donna arrive from school, hungry and ready for a before-dinner snack. Since It takes enormous quantities of food to satisfy the appetites of four growing children and a hard-working farmer-husband, Mrs. Nevin spends much of her time in the kitchen. Naturally, both boys like to help with cookie making and little Jimmy, licking chocolate off the beater," smeared the sweet stuff on both face and arms and had to be cleaned up. The Nevins' two younger children, Jimmy, 18 months old, and Denny, 354 years, sometimes watch the afternoon television shows while their 1 mother browses through a woman's magazine, The large farmhouse has many attractive rooms, .
